I (D,B)-supra pre maps via supra topological ordered spaces

Sayed [19] defined a supra 𝑝𝑟𝑒-open set and studied its basic properties. In this work, we introduce various forms of supra continuous (supra open, supra closed, supra homeomorphism) maps in supra topological ordered spaces by using the notions of supra 𝑝𝑟𝑒-open sets and increasing (decreasing, balancing) sets. We illustrate the relationships among these maps with the help of examples. Moreover, we investigate under what conditions these maps preserve some separation axioms between supra topological ordered spaces.
